

3.6mm 3MP M12 wide angle lens for 1/2.7″ and 1/3″ sensors, offering up to 121° diagonal FOV, F2.4 aperture, 0.2m M.O.D., and compact M12×0.5 integration for machine vision, embedded cameras, and wide-area imaging.
S03612710024F is 3.6mm High-Quality wide angle lens with Built-In Filter, 3-megapixel resolution CCTV lens, F2.4 aperture M12/S-mount lens.
| IMAGE FORMAT | 1/2.7″, 1/3″ |
| FOCAL LENGTH | 3.6mm |
| F.O.V.@1/2.7″ | 121°(D) |
| 100°(H) | |
| 52°(V) | |
| DISTORTION | <-33% |
| F.O.V.@1/3″ AR0330 | 107°(D) |
| 85°(H) | |
| 54°(V) | |
| DISTORTION | <-25% |
| RESOLUTION | 3Megapixel |
| APERTURE | F2.4 |
| MOUNT | M12X0.5 |
| IRIS | Fixed |
| B.F.L. | 6.2mm |
| M.O.D. | 0.2m |
| STRUCTURE | 5G+IRCF |
This 3.6mm 3MP M12 wide angle lens is designed for compact imaging systems that require broad scene coverage, flexible sensor compatibility, and reliable close-to-medium distance imaging. Supporting both 1/2.7″ and 1/3″ image formats, the lens provides different field-of-view performance according to the connected sensor, making it suitable for embedded vision cameras, compact machine vision devices, smart monitoring equipment, and other space-constrained imaging applications.
With a 3.6mm focal length, F2.4 aperture, M12×0.5 mount, and 0.2m minimum object distance, this fixed focal lens provides a practical balance between wide-angle coverage and image stability. At 1/2.7″, it delivers a 121° diagonal FOV, while the 1/3″ format provides a 107° diagonal FOV. The 5G+IRCF optical construction further supports compact optical integration where an IR-cut filter is required.

The combination of a 3.6mm focal length and wide field of view makes this lens suitable for applications where the camera must cover a relatively large area without significantly increasing the physical size of the imaging system. The 121° diagonal FOV available with a 1/2.7″ sensor can be useful for monitoring areas, detecting objects across a broad scene, and capturing spatial information in compact equipment.
The 1/3″ compatibility provides additional flexibility for camera manufacturers working with smaller sensors. Its 107° diagonal FOV and <-25% distortion specification provide a different optical balance when paired with a 1/3″ image sensor.
This lens is Designed for compact machine vision application where installation space is limited but a wider viewing area is required. The 3MP resolution, fixed focal configuration, and 0.2m M.O.D. make it suitable for inspection and detection tasks where the camera needs to observe objects at relatively short distances.

The lens supports both 1/2.7″ and 1/3″ image formats, but the resulting field of view is different. With a 1/2.7″ sensor, the lens provides 121° diagonal, 100° horizontal, and 52° vertical FOV. With a 1/3″ sensor, the corresponding FOV is 107° diagonal, 85° horizontal, and 54° vertical.
This makes sensor selection an important part of system design. Camera manufacturers should evaluate the actual sensor size, required coverage, working distance, and image area before finalizing the optical configuration. The lens has a specified distortion of <-33% with a 1/2.7″ sensor and <-25% with a 1/3″ sensor. These figures reflect its wide-angle optical design rather than a low-distortion architecture.
For applications such as general wide-area monitoring, presence detection, and broad scene observation, this level of distortion may be acceptable. However, applications requiring accurate dimensional measurement, geometric inspection, or precision positioning should evaluate distortion requirements carefully. Q: What sensors are compatible with this 3.6mm M12 lens?
A: The lens supports both 1/2.7″ and 1/3″ image formats, with different FOV and distortion performance for each sensor size.
Q: What is the field of view of this M12 wide angle lens?
A: With a 1/2.7″ sensor, the lens provides 121° diagonal, 100° horizontal, and 52° vertical FOV. With a 1/3″ sensor, it provides 107° diagonal, 85° horizontal, and 54° vertical FOV.
Q: Is this a low distortion lens?
A: No. With distortion specified at <-33% for 1/2.7″ and <-25% for 1/3″, this lens should be considered a wide-angle lens rather than a precision low-distortion lens.
Q: What is the minimum object distance of this lens?
A: The M.O.D. is 0.2m, making the lens suitable for relatively close-range imaging and compact equipment where the camera is installed near the target.
Q: What mount does this lens use?
A: The lens uses an M12×0.5 mount, a common interface for compact embedded cameras, industrial cameras, and machine vision modules.
Q: Is this lens suitable for machine vision?
A: Yes. Its 3MP resolution, wide FOV, 0.2m M.O.D., and compact M12 mount make it suitable for selected machine vision and industrial inspection systems, particularly where broad scene coverage is more important than precision geometric measurement.
Q: What does IRCF mean in the optical structure?
A: IRCF indicates that an IR-cut filter is incorporated into the optical construction. It should not be interpreted as the same as an IR-corrected lens designed to maintain focus across visible and infrared wavelengths.
